What is the purpose of this form?

The purpose of the Point-of-Care Medical Record Checklist is to streamline the auditing process of patient medical records. This checklist assists healthcare professionals in verifying the integrity of medical documentation which is critical to patient care. By utilizing this checklist, organizations can enhance the accuracy, compliance, and overall quality of patient records.

Tell me about this form and its components and fields line-by-line.

The form consists of a series of fields designed to capture essential data relating to patient medical records. It includes items such as demographic information, medical assessments, consent forms, and treatment plans.
fields
  • 1. Demographic Information: Includes patient details such as name, address, date of birth, and ethnicity.
  • 2. Advance Directives: Documents the patient’s preferences for healthcare and treatment.
  • 3. History and Physical Exam: Records findings from physical examinations and medical history.
  • 4. Medications: Covers reconciliation of medications prescribed or administered.
  • 5. Communication Needs: Captures any language or cultural needs affecting patient care.
